surface area of small intestine:

The small intestine is the site where almost all digestion and absorption of nutrients and minerals from food takes place.The large surface area of the small intestine is very important because this is where nutrients from digestive food particles are absorbed into the surface lining cells and from there into the blood stream and lymphatics.The total surface area,stretched out,would be about the floor area of a small apartment.This large surface area allows ample interaction of digested molecules with the cell membranes so that absorption can occur efficiently.In otherwords, the increased surface area(in contact with the fluid in lumen) decreases the average distance travelled by the nutrient molecules so the effectiveness of diffusion increases.

Effects on the carbon reservoir:

a.cutting down large tracts of rain forest and exporting the lumber have a devastating effect on the climate.lumber is the conomically most important product from the rain forest,and has a value on the world market estimated at 7,000 million US dollars a year.Tropical rainforest deforestration contributes upto 30% of all the carbondioxide human beings add to the atmosphere (Lewis,1990).This lead to increase of co​​​​​2​​​​ ratio in the atmospheric reservoir and cause global warming by releasing other gases which threatens agriculture and the quality of life worldwide.

b.Burning of fossil fuels:

when fossil fuels like coal and oil are burned,carbon is released into the atmosphere at a faster rate than it is removed.As a result,the concentration of carbon dioxide in the atmosphere increases.The ocean absorbs much of the carbon dioxide that is released by burning fossil fuels.This extra carbon dioxide is lowering the oceans pH through a process called ocean acidification.ocean acidification interferes with the ability of marine organisms to build their shells and skeletoskeleton

C.warming surface water of oceans:

CO​​​​​2 dissolves with the waters and then reacts with the water so that it dissociates into several ions.This dissociation means that oceans can hold a lot of carbon- about 80% of the active reservoir on earth.cold sea water can hold more CO2 than warm water.This means that are cool and are cooling tend to take up carbon and waters that are warming tend to emit carbon.As gases become less soluble in water as its temperature increases.warming the surface waters of the oceans ultimately decrease the carbon influx or input from the atmosphere into the ocean water.
